    Haven’t made it up in years, but it was good Scrogin .
    Energy chocolate, raisins, salted peanuts, dried fruit cut up apricot, glucose tablets broken into bits.
    Just carried in a plastic zip tie bag, grab a handful every now and then, on the run.
    Suppose snack bars, are easier but that mix worked well

    This is an interesting article about sodium supplements and ultramarathon runners.
    https://relentlessforwardcommotion.c...ltramarathons/

    From what I could see taking sodium supplements made no difference to hyponatremia. It seemed that the major predictor of hyponatremia was a lack of preparation, in that it seemed to occur more in runners that had done less training.
